Monday, Feb. 11, 2013 – Long, Fabulous Ride Today!




Had a good night’s sleep, then saddled up after breakfast to take our final, and hopefully, longest ride. Despite being ridden more in the last week than they have in the last few weeks, the horses were quite happy to get out again after their day off, at least once we got on to a new trail. After taking the usual half mile or so of Blue trail, we took the north Orange loop, doing lots of trotting and cantering (and even a short gallop!) until we came to the primitive camping area, which is pretty much in the middle of the park. There is a pavilion and a hand pump with a trough, plus an extra picnic table or two scattered around. There was also a ranger and his pickup truck there, spraying some unwanted foliage around. Hubby and I munched on a couple of chicken sandwiches I had made, gave the horses a couple of apples, and then two more riders came in. Two women, Pam was one of them, who had started on the west side of the park (we had come from the east), one of them apparently has some land over there, so they can reach the park directly from her stables. We chatted a bit before heading back out on the trail, this time taking the part of the Orange trail we had missed on Saturday, the south route as it were. We got a lot more trotting and cantering in, avoided some black snakes (I’ve seen a lot of them around here), and arrived back safe and sound around 4:00. Gave the horses a quick bath (their third since we’ve been here!), spent a little time getting ready to leave tomorrow, then settled in for the evening.
